'Night Skies' is a beautiful and unusual pink perennial wallflower whose peachy-pink flowers gradually darken purple as they age. The blooms have a strong scent and bees love them.

It's a nice compact form which flowers for weeks on end from early spring to early summer, sometimes and sometimes over winter too.

Erysimum are fast growing and happy in any sunny spot, provided the soil isn't boggy. They tolerate very dry soil once they are established. They are very hardy and last for several years.

In the 12th century, Troubadours would wear a sprig of wallflower to signify that their love survive time and misfortune. It is said that this is as a result of seeing the plant growing on the ruins of fallen towers, the rather romantic image of beauty and fragrance amongst desolation.
